Está en la página 1de 2

2021

UNIVERSIDAD GALILEO
Diseño e Implementación del Software

Patrones de diseño y patrones de arquitectura

José Dionició Elias


20000219
Para poder definir cual es la diferencia entre Arquitectura de
Software y Diseño de Software debemos enteder la difinicios de
cada uno de ellos.

Arquitectura de Software: Es dividir el sistema en elementos de


software, definir la funcionalidad de cada elemento y establecer las
relaciones entre los elementos para la construccion de software. Por
lo que se puede definir com Arquitectura de Software el diseño del
más alto nivel de la estructura de un sistema.

Diseño de Software: Según Roger Pressman el diseño de


software agrupa el conjunto de principios, conceptos y practicas que
llevan al desarrollo de un sistema o producto de alta calidad, esto
quiere decir que es el momento donde de une toda la creatividad
para hacer el diseño de la concepción del software, deben de estar
los requisitos.

La diferencia entre ambas definiciones radica en que la Arquitectura


de Software es el armazón o estructura del sistema, sus
propiedades visibles, si lo relacionamos como la arquitectura de un
edificio seria como va a ir cada nive, donde quedarian los elevadore
las gradas de emergencia y el Diseño va a dar los detalles del
diseño del sistema, en este caso si nuevamente lo relacionamos a la
construccion de un edificio este caso seria el estilo de las gradas, de
que material estarian hecho los elevadores o que sistema utilizarian.

En conclución la arquitectura de software es la estructura, como los


componentes protocolos para cumplir el con el diseño del software
y el diseño del software se emplea en los aspectos del
comportamiento.

También podría gustarte